Home
last modified time | relevance | path

Searched refs:IMA_APPRAISE (Results 1 - 12 of 12) sorted by relevance

/kernel/linux/linux-5.10/security/integrity/
H A Dintegrity.h24 #define IMA_APPRAISE 0x00000004 macro
43 #define IMA_DO_MASK (IMA_MEASURE | IMA_APPRAISE | IMA_AUDIT | \
/kernel/linux/linux-6.6/security/integrity/
H A Dintegrity.h25 #define IMA_APPRAISE 0x00000004 macro
45 #define IMA_DO_MASK (IMA_MEASURE | IMA_APPRAISE | IMA_AUDIT | \
/kernel/linux/linux-5.10/security/integrity/ima/
H A Dima_init.c105 int unset_flags = ima_policy_flag & IMA_APPRAISE; in ima_load_x509()
H A Dima_appraise.c75 IMA_APPRAISE | IMA_HASH, NULL, NULL, NULL); in ima_must_appraise()
513 if (!(ima_policy_flag & IMA_APPRAISE) || !S_ISREG(inode->i_mode) in ima_inode_post_setattr()
548 if (!(ima_policy_flag & IMA_APPRAISE) || !S_ISREG(inode->i_mode)) in ima_reset_appraise_flags()
H A Dima_main.c218 /* Return an IMA_MEASURE, IMA_APPRAISE, IMA_AUDIT action in process_measurement()
229 must_appraise = action & IMA_APPRAISE; in process_measurement()
258 iint->flags &= ~(IMA_APPRAISE | IMA_APPRAISED | in process_measurement()
445 if (!(ima_policy_flag & IMA_APPRAISE) || !vma->vm_file || in ima_file_mprotect()
H A Dima_api.c183 * Returns IMA_MEASURE, IMA_APPRAISE mask.
191 int flags = IMA_MEASURE | IMA_AUDIT | IMA_APPRAISE | IMA_HASH; in ima_get_action()
H A Dima_policy.c41 #define APPRAISE 0x0004 /* same as IMA_APPRAISE */
631 * @flags: IMA actions to consider (e.g. IMA_MEASURE | IMA_APPRAISE)
668 if (entry->action & IMA_APPRAISE) { in ima_match_policy()
712 ima_policy_flag &= ~IMA_APPRAISE; in ima_update_policy_flag()
/kernel/linux/linux-6.6/security/integrity/ima/
H A Dima_init.c104 int unset_flags = ima_policy_flag & IMA_APPRAISE; in ima_load_x509()
H A Dima_appraise.c83 func, mask, IMA_APPRAISE | IMA_HASH, NULL, in ima_must_appraise()
645 if (!(ima_policy_flag & IMA_APPRAISE) || !S_ISREG(inode->i_mode) in ima_inode_post_setattr()
678 if (!(ima_policy_flag & IMA_APPRAISE) || !S_ISREG(inode->i_mode)) in ima_reset_appraise_flags()
H A Dima_main.c229 /* Return an IMA_MEASURE, IMA_APPRAISE, IMA_AUDIT action in process_measurement()
242 must_appraise = action & IMA_APPRAISE; in process_measurement()
271 iint->flags &= ~(IMA_APPRAISE | IMA_APPRAISED | in process_measurement()
482 if (!(ima_policy_flag & IMA_APPRAISE) || !vma->vm_file || in ima_file_mprotect()
H A Dima_api.c186 * Returns IMA_MEASURE, IMA_APPRAISE mask.
195 int flags = IMA_MEASURE | IMA_AUDIT | IMA_APPRAISE | IMA_HASH; in ima_get_action()
H A Dima_policy.c45 #define APPRAISE 0x0004 /* same as IMA_APPRAISE */
724 * @flags: IMA actions to consider (e.g. IMA_MEASURE | IMA_APPRAISE)
764 if (entry->action & IMA_APPRAISE) { in ima_match_policy()
844 new_policy_flag &= ~IMA_APPRAISE; in ima_update_policy_flags()

Completed in 13 milliseconds